This Linux kernel change "Merge branch ‘drm-fixes-5.2’ of git:// into drm-fixes" is included in the Linux 5.2 release. This change is authored by Daniel Vetter <daniel.vetter [at]> on Fri Jun 14 17:46:54 2019 +0200. The commit for this change in Linux stable tree is e14c587 (patch). Other info about this change: Merge: 744ed8c f3a5231

Fixes for 5.2:
- Extend previous vce fix for resume to uvd and vcn
- Fix bounds checking in ras debugfs interface
- Fix a regression on SI using amdgpu

Signed-off-by: Daniel Vetter <[email protected]>
From: Alex Deucher <[email protected]>
Link:[email protected]

 drivers/gpu/drm/amd/amdgpu/amdgpu_pm.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_pm.c b/drivers/gpu/drm/amd/amdgpu/amdgpu_pm.c
index 039cfa2..abeaab4 100644
--- a/drivers/gpu/drm/amd/amdgpu/amdgpu_pm.c
+++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_pm.c
@@ -2492,7 +2492,7 @@ void amdgpu_pm_print_power_states(struct amdgpu_device *adev)

 int amdgpu_pm_load_smu_firmware(struct amdgpu_device *adev, uint32_t *smu_version)
-   int r = -EINVAL;
+   int r;

    if (adev->powerplay.pp_funcs && adev->powerplay.pp_funcs->load_firmware) {
        r = adev->powerplay.pp_funcs->load_firmware(adev->powerplay.pp_handle);
@@ -2502,7 +2502,7 @@ int amdgpu_pm_load_smu_firmware(struct amdgpu_device *adev, uint32_t *smu_versio
        *smu_version = adev->pm.fw_version;
-   return r;
+   return 0;

 int amdgpu_pm_sysfs_init(struct amdgpu_device *adev)

